13 reasons why the OPPO Reno13 5G deserves your attention
Cutting-edge technology in a sleek aesthetic!
In a sea of midrange smartphones, standing out takes more than just good specs. The OPPO Reno13 5G proves that with AI-powered features, a sleek design, and reliable performance, it’s a device worth considering.
Here’s why it deserves your attention.
Underwater photography mode
Not just splash-proof, this phone is fully adventure-ready. With an IP69 rating, the OPPO Reno13 5G can survive up to under 2 meters in fresh water for 30 minutes.
Capture poolside moments or waterfalls effortlessly, thanks to a screen-locking feature that prevents accidental swipes. Just use the volume buttons to snap stunning underwater shots!
AI-powered portraits that stun
The OPPO Reno13 5G lives up to its AI Portrait Expert title with features like AI Eraser 2.0 (removes photo-bombers), AI Clarity Enhancer (sharpens details), and AI Reflection Remover (eliminates glare).
Your selfies, travel shots, and street photography will always be crisp, clear, and social media-ready without extra editing.
50MP camera with AI magic
A 50MP Sony sensor paired with OPPO’s AI tech ensures vibrant, high-detail photos in any setting. Whether in daylight or low light, you get pro-quality shots every time.
4K ultra-clear video
Whether you’re a vlogger or just love capturing everyday moments, the OPPO Reno13 5G’s 4K video recording delivers cinema-like clarity. AI stabilization keeps your videos smooth even when you’re on the move.
AI HyperBoost: Game on, Lag off
Mobile gamers will love AI HyperBoost, which optimizes system performance, reduces frame drops, and ensures lag-free gaming.
Pair that with a 120Hz adaptive refresh rate and a peak brightness of 1200 nits, and your gaming experience stays smooth and immersive, even in bright sunlight.
A Visual Masterpiece
The OPPO Reno13 5G isn’t just powerful. It’s gorgeous. Its Butterfly Shadow design, created through a unique laser-etched technique, makes the glass back shimmer beautifully in the light.
Crafted with aerospace-grade aluminum, it’s stylish, durable, and undeniably eye-catching.
Display that’s easy on the eyes
The 120Hz AMOLED panel delivers ultra-smooth scrolling and vibrant colors. Whether you’re gaming, streaming, or scrolling through social media, the OPPO Reno13 5G ensures a comfortable and enjoyable viewing experience.
Power that keeps up with you
With a 5,600mAh battery, the OPPO Reno13 5G easily lasts more than a day on a single charge.
And when you need a quick boost, 80W SuperVOOC fast charging powers up your phone in under an hour.
Seamless multitasking
Pow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 8100-Ultra, this phone intelligently optimizes performance to ensure fast, smooth multitasking whether you’re gaming, streaming, or juggling multiple apps at once.
Work Smarter, Not Harder
Beyond photography and gaming, AI enhances everyday tasks. AI Writer and AI Summary help streamline your workflow by summarizing articles or perfecting social media captions.
It’s like having a personal assistant in your pocket!
Seamless connectivity with 5G and Wi-Fi 6
Stay ahead with ultra-fast 5G speeds, Wi-Fi 6 support, and improved signal stability ensuring uninterrupted browsing, gaming, and streaming.
Durability that’s ready for anything
Featuring IP69 water resistance, dust protection, and Gorilla Glass 5, the OPPO Reno13 5G is built to withstand the elements whether you’re hiking, running, or just caught in the rain.
Affordable AI in the Midrange Segment
Despite all these premium AI features, the OPPO Reno13 5G remains a budget-friendly powerhouse. Perfect for content creators, travelers, and gamers who want top-tier performance without the flagship price tag.
It’s the midrange smartphone to watch!
The OPPO Reno13 5G isn’t just another midrange phone. It’s an AI-powered portrait expert, a gaming beast, and a travel companion all rolled into one.
With flagship-level features like IP69 water resistance, AI-enhanced photography, smooth 120Hz display, and long battery life, it delivers incredible value without breaking the bank.
If you’re looking for a smartphone that can keep up with your lifestyle, whether it’s for content creation, gaming, or everyday productivity, the OPPO Reno13 5G is the midrange phone to watch.
The OPPO Reno13 5G (12GB+512GB) retails for PhP 34,999, and comes in two colorways: Plume White and Luminous Blue.
It’s already available in select OPPO official brand stores in the Philippines.

For more than a decade, the smartphone industry has been defined by a familiar race. More megapixels. Faster processors. Bigger batteries. Thinner designs. Being first. Being the most. And being the fastest.
The industry rewarded brands that appeared to be chasing specs. Bigger numbers meant progress. At least on paper.
But if you ask Samsung, the days of chasing specs may no longer define the future of Galaxy smartphones.
During a regional roundtable following the launch of the latest Galaxy devices, I asked TM Roh how the company decides when it’s time for a major hardware upgrade if it isn’t simply chasing specs.
His answer revealed how Samsung now approaches the future of its flagship smartphones.
According to Roh, hardware upgrades are increasingly tied to how well they support Galaxy AI.
“To make Galaxy AI run smoothly, it must be backed by strong hardware,” Roh said during the session, speaking through a translator. He added that Samsung develops its hardware, software, and AI capabilities together — and that major upgrades tend to arrive only when the company reaches what he described as the “desired level of excellence.”
(Quotes are approximate translations.)
“To make Galaxy AI run smoothly, it must be backed by strong hardware.”
(Approximate translation from TM Roh during the roundtable)
In short, Samsung says it’s no longer chasing specs for the sake of winning spec-sheet battles. Not anymore.
When hardware stops chasing numbers
Hardware innovation still matters. But Samsung increasingly frames those improvements as tools that enable smarter software experiences.
During the roundtable, Roh pointed to Samsung’s custom application processors, which now include stronger neural processing capabilities designed to handle AI workloads more efficiently. Dedicated hardware is also being introduced to strengthen privacy and security — including technologies embedded directly into the display. (See: Privacy Display)
Even cameras, historically one of the biggest battlegrounds for smartphone innovation, are evolving in the same direction.
Roh noted that while sensors and lenses remain important, modern smartphone photography now relies heavily on AI-powered image processing working alongside the hardware. This could also explain why, as of writing, Samsung has resisted the extra telephoto lens accessories that is prevalent with other brands.
The shift is subtle but important. Instead of emphasizing bigger numbers on spec sheets, Samsung positions hardware upgrades as part of a broader system designed to support intelligent software.
Why Samsung gets dunked on online
That philosophy, however, exists in tension with how smartphones are often discussed online.
In a landscape driven by benchmark charts and viral comparisons, incremental refinement rarely generates the same excitement as dramatic hardware leaps. Over the past few years, the Galaxy S series has occasionally become an easy target for criticism — especially as rival Android manufacturers compete to deliver the biggest numbers, the fastest charging speeds, or the thinnest designs.
The temptation in tech media, particularly on platforms like YouTube, is often to dunk on Samsung rather than examine the nuance behind its approach. Spectacular upgrades and dramatic spec sheets make better thumbnails.
Yet listening to Samsung executives across multiple briefings reveals something interesting: the messaging is remarkably consistent. Whether discussing cameras, processors, or ecosystem features, the company repeatedly returns to the same principle. Hardware innovation matters most when it unlocks a better overall experience.
A company that knows its role
That consistency suggests Samsung knows exactly who it is in the smartphone industry.
As the largest Android smartphone manufacturer globally, Samsung occupies a position where competitors often measure themselves against it. Many brands differentiate by pushing aggressive specifications or experimenting with bold hardware changes.
In many ways, everyone else is punching up.
Scale changes priorities. When you’re building devices for hundreds of millions of users, the focus shifts toward reliability, ecosystem integration, and increasingly, AI-powered experiences that work consistently across products.
Why Southeast Asia matters in Samsung’s AI strategy
During the roundtable, Roh also emphasized the importance of Southeast Asia and Oceania to Samsung’s AI strategy.
According to the company’s internal research, the region ranks among the most receptive markets for AI-powered mobile features. Younger demographics and heavy social media usage are driving adoption.
In markets where smartphones are central to communication, content creation, and digital services, AI-powered tools — from translation features to image editing — have found strong traction.
That context helps explain why Samsung continues to position AI as the defining layer of its next-generation devices.
Is the smartphone spec race ending?
For years, smartphone makers built their identities around chasing specs.
Bigger numbers meant better phones. Faster chips meant progress.
Samsung, it seems, is chasing something else.
Whether that bet ultimately reshapes the smartphone experience remains to be seen. But if Roh’s comments are any indication, the next major leap in Galaxy hardware won’t happen simply because the numbers can go higher.
It will happen when Samsung believes the experience — not the spec sheet — is ready to move forward.
